VIU Trades & Health Programs

 

This unique opportunity enables dual credit courses to be offered to qualified Grade 11 & 12 students. Students successfully completing these courses receive elective credits towards their Dogwood Diploma as well as university credits which are also accepted at other BC universities including VIU.

This offering enables students to:

  • get a head start on their post-secondary studies while remaining within the secondary school support system.
  • earn dual (double) credits for each course.
  • gain access to university and college.

Applied Business Technology 
This program provides in-depth training in the skills required by today’s office workers. The program offers certificates in the following specialty areas of study: Administrative Assistant, Accounting Assistant, and Legal Administrative Assistant. Current computer software applications and accurate keyboarding techniques are emphasized, in addition to knowledge in areas such as business English, math and calculators, office procedures, and human relations. Specialty courses relevant to each certificate are also included. The certificate includes a two-week work experience where students have the opportunity to practice their skills working with a local business. Graduates demonstrate a multitude of transferable skills that support them in pursuing their education and employment goals.

Carpentry
This Entry-Level Trades Training (ELTT) program covers the basic carpentry skills required in preparation for employment as a carpenter apprentice in the building industry.

Hairdressing
This apprenticeship program covers all the theory required to become a BC certified hairdresser. Client services are offered to enhance practical skills in the Salon. A work based training component is included.

Health Care Assistant
This program provides the knowledge and skills to work with and support the needs of older adults in a variety of healthcare settings. Academic and practical course work will be delivered on the caregiver’s roles and responsibilities.

Heating, Ventilation & Air-Conditioning/Refrigeration
This program prepares individuals for entry into the heating (gas and oil), air-conditioning, and refrigeration industry service sector. The program provides a solid foundation in the fundamentals of installing, servicing, and troubleshooting all aspects of heating, ventilating and air-conditioning/ refrigeration (HVAC/R) equipment, as well as customer relations.

Professional Cook Level 1
Learn through extensive hand-on instruction, the theory of cooking, cooking methods and techniques of food preparation such as knife skills, safety, diet and nutrition, stocks, soups and sauces, meat, poultry and seafood cookery, grilling, roasting, braising, etc. This certificate qualifies students to work in industry.

Introduction to Trades Core Program
This career program is designed to introduce a wide array of trade awareness activities. Module will include the following trade areas: carpentry, documentation and plan reading, electrical, plumbing, painting, drywall, sheet metal and tile setting. The program will focus on the development of work readiness skills essential to the workplace.
